The xl6009 is a buck boost switching regulator meaning it takes in an input voltage and then switches it to produce a regulated output voltage which could be greater or lesser than the input voltage. It can be configured as either a boost flyback sepic or inverting converter.

The xl6009 built in n channel power mosfet and fixed frequency oscillator current mode architecture results in stable operation over a wide range of supply and output voltages. The xl6009 regulator is fixed frequency pwm boost step up dc dc converter capable of driving 5a switching current with excellent line and load regulation.
